Tapping into the Power of AI: Revolutionizing Software Solutions
Understanding Artificial Intelligence
Artificial intelligence (AI) refers to the simulation of human intelligence in machines. These systems can perform tasks that typically require human cognition. They analyze data, recognize patterns, and make decisions. This capability enhances software development processes significantly.
AI can automate repetitive tasks. This leads to increased efficiency. It also allows developers to focus on more complex problems. Many organizations are adopting AI tools. They seek to improve their software solutions.
AI technologies include machine learning and natural language processing. These tools enable software to learn from data and understand human language. This is a game changer. The integration of AI in software development is essential. It drives innovation and improves user experiences.
The Evolution of Software Solutions
Software solutions have evolved significantly over the decades. Early systems were basic and limited in functionality. They primarily focused on data processing. As technology advanced, software became more sophisticated. This evolution included the introduction of graphical user interfaces and network capabilities.
Today, software solutions are highly integrated. They often utilize cloud computing and mobile platforms. This allows for greater accessibility and collaboration. Many users expect seamless experiences across devices. It’s essential to adapt to these changes. The landscape is constantly shifting.
Key Benefits of AI in Software
Enhanced Efficiency and Productivity
AI significantly enhances efficiency in software development. It automates routine tasks, reducing time spent on manual processes. This leads to increased productivity across teams. By streamlining workflows, organizations can allocate resources more effectively.
Data analysis becomes faster and more accurate with AI. This allows for informed decision-making based on real-time insights. Many companies experience improved financial performance as a result. It’s a smart investment. The benefits are clear and compelling.
Improved Decision-Making Capabilities
AI enhances decision-making capabilities in software development. It analyzes vast amounts of data quickly. This allows him to identify trends and patterns. Consequently, he can make informed choices based on evidence.
Moreover, predictive analytics helps anticipate future outcomes. This proactive approach minimizes risks and maximizes opportunities. Many professionals find this invaluable. It leads to better strategic planning. The impact is significant and measurable.
AI Technologies Transforming Software
Machine Learning and Its Applications
Machine learning is a subset of AI that enables systems to learn from data. It enhances predictive modeling and risk assessment. This capability is crucial in financial forecasting. By analyzing historical data, he can identify potential market trends.
Additionally, machine learning algorithms optimize resource allocation. This leads to cost savings and improved operational efficiency. Many professionals recognize its transformative potential. It drives innovation in software solutions. The advantages are clear and compelling.
Natural Language Processing in Software
Natural linguistic communication processing (NLP) enables software to understand human language. This technology is essential for sentiment analysis in financial markets. By interpreting customer feedback, he can gauge market sentiment effectively.
NLP also enhances chatbots and virtual assistants. These tools provide real-time support and information. Many organizations benefit from improved customer engagement. It streamlines communication and reduces response times. The impact on user experience is significant.
Case Studies: AI in Action
Successful Implementations in Various Industries
AI has been successfully implemented across various industries, demonstrating its versatility. In healthcare, predictive analytics helps in patient diagnosis and treatment planning. This leads to improved patient outcomes.
In finance, algorithmic trading utilizes AI to analyze market data. He can execute trades at optimal times, maximizing returns. Retailers also leverage AI for inventory management. This reduces costs and enhances supply chain efficiency. The results are impressive and measurable.
Lessons Learned from AI Integration
Integrating AI into business processes reveals several key lessons. First, data quality is paramount for effective AI performance. Poor data leads to inaccurate insights. Organizations must prioritize data governance and management.
Additionally, employee training is essential for successful adoption. He needs to understand AI tools to maximize their potential. Resistance to change can hinder progress. Engaging stakeholders early fosters a collaborative environment. These strategies enhance overall effectiveness and drive results.
Challenges in Implementing AI Solutions
Technical and Infrastructure Barriers
Implementing AI solutions often faces technical and infrastructure barriers. Legacy systems may lack compatibility with new technologies. This can lead to increased costs and delays. Additionally, insufficient data infrastructure hampers effective AI deployment.
Organizations must invest in modernizing their systems. This is crucial for seamless integration. Moreover, cybersecurity concerns can deter AI adoption. Protecting sensitive data is essential. The risks are significant and must be addressed.
Ethical Considerations and Bias
Ethical considerations and bias present significant challenges in AI implementation. Algorithms can inadvertently perpetuate existing biases in data. This leads to unfair outcomes in decision-making processes. Moreover, transparency in AI systems is crucial for accountability.
Organizations must ensure ethical guidelines are followed. This fosters trust among stakeholders. Regular audits can help identify biases. It’s essential to address these issues proactively. The implications are profound and far-reaching.
The Future of AI in Software Development
Emerging Trends and Innovations
Emerging trends in AI indicate a shift towards more adaptive systems. These systems leverage real-time data for enhanced decision-making. He can respond to market changes swiftly. Additionally, the integration of AI with blockchain technology is gaining traction. This combination enhances security and transparency in transactions.
Furthermore, low-code and no-code platforms are democratizing AI development. This allows non-technical users to create applications easily. The landscape is evolving rapidly. Staying informed is essential for success.
Predictions for the Next Decade
In the next decade, AI will increasingly drive automation across industries. This will enhance operational efficiency and reduce costs. He can expect more personalized customer experiences through advanced analytics. Additionally, AI will play a crucial role in predictive modeling for financial markets.
As data privacy regulations evolve, compliance will become paramount. Organizations must prioritize ethical AI practices. The landscape will be competitive and dynamic. Adapting quickly is essential for success.
Conclusion: Embracing AI for Software Success
Strategoes for Effective AI Adoption
To adopt AI effectively, organizations should start with a clear strategy. This includes identifying specific use cases that align with business goals. He must ensure stakeholder engagement throughout the process. Training employees on AI tools is also essential for success.
Moreover, investing in robust data infrastructure is crucial. Quality data drives accurate AI outcomes. Regular assessments of AI performance will help refine strategies. Continuous improvement is key. The benefits are substantial and transformative.
Final Thoughts on the AI Revolution
The AI revolution is reshaping industries and redefining success. Organizations that embrace AI can enhance operational efficiency and drive innovation. He must recognize the importance of strategic implementation. This includes aligning AI initiatives with business objectives.
Moreover, ethical considerations are paramount in AI deployment. Ensuring transparency and accountability builds trust with stakeholders. Continuous learning and adaptation will be essential in this evolving landscape. The potential for growth is immense. Embracing AI is a strategic imperative.
Leave a Reply
You must be logged in to post a comment.